'Gitmo gives terrorists powerful recruitment tool' (VIDEO)








It's now half a year since Guantanamo's prisoners began their hunger strike.

The US military says the self-imposed starvation protest is waning - because inmates have been eating after dusk as is tradition in the holy month of Ramadan.

But painful force-feeding procedures and invasive body searches are still part of the daily routine for many of the prisoners.

Keeping the prison running, meanwhile, seems to serve as a recruitment tool for terrorists worldwide - that's what the senior counter-terrorism counsel for Human Rights Watch told RT.
